how do the suspension bushes cope with the height adjustment kit
am i right in thinking that for example the front lower arm suspension inner bushes do not rotate on the bolts?
if i am right, the eccentric bolts are holding the bush in place and the arm can only move as much as the rubber in the bushes "flexes"
or have i got something wrong?
